🔧 Key Specs
Feature | Specification |
---|---|
Display | 6.67″ AMOLED – 1440×3200 px, 120 Hz, 3200 nits peak |
Chipset | Snapdragon 8 Elite (Gen3) |
RAM/Storage | 12 GB/16 GB RAM; 256 GB–1 TB UFS 4.0 |
Rear Cameras | 50 MP (wide) + 50 MP telephoto (3×) + 32 MP ultrawide |
Front Camera | 20 MP |
Battery | 6000 mAh, 120 W wired & 50 W wireless fast charge |
OS | Android 15, HyperOS 2.0 |
Others | IP68, Gorilla Glass, Vapor chamber cooling |
🖥 Display – Premium Visuals
With a 2K AMOLED panel featuring Dolby Vision and up to 3200 nits brightness, the K80 Pro delivers crisp visuals and punchy HDR content. The 120 Hz refresh ensures smooth scrolling for browsing, gaming, or content editing.

🚀 Performance & Benchmarks
The Snapdragon 8 Elite chipset delivers flagship-level performance:

- Geekbench 6 scoring: ~3050 (single-core), ~9184 (multi-core)
- 3DMark Wild Life: ~20K @ 120 FPS
Multitasking, gaming, and creative apps run effortlessly on both 12 GB and 16 GB RAM variants.

📸 Camera System – Versatile and Sharp
The triple camera setup includes:
- 50 MP wide with optical stabilization
- 50 MP telephoto with true 3× zoom
- 32 MP ultrawide
Photos are sharp with natural tones, and 8K recording (24fps) adds versatility. Selfie shots with the 20 MP front camera are equally crisp.

🔋 Battery & Charging
A massive 6000 mAh battery ensures flawless day-long usage. The highlight is the 120 W wired fast charge—getting you from 0 to 80% in ~23 minutes and full in ~32 minutes. Wireless charging at 50 W is also supported
⚙️ Software & Additional Features
Running Android 15 with HyperOS 2.0, the K80 Pro is clean and intuitive. It includes enhancements like vapor chamber cooling, IP68 durability, Gorilla Glass protection, and Wi‑Fi 7 support.
✅ Pros & Cons
👍 Pros:
- Flagship-grade performance
- Stunning 2K AMOLED display
- Lightning-fast charging
- Flexible triple-camera suite
- Large battery and robust build
👎 Cons:
- No expandable storage
- MIUI-style HyperOS may include ads
- Slightly bulky at ~212 g
🏁 Final Verdict
At around ₹55,000, the Redmi K80 Pro delivers flagship-class performance, display, and battery tech, making it one of the most compelling power phones of 2024‑25. If you prioritize raw performance and fast charging—and don’t mind the size—it’s a standout in its segment.
